On Friday, September 19, 2025, India will face Oman in the 12th match of Group A in the Asia Cup 2025 at the Sheikh Zayed Cricket Stadium in Abu Dhabi. With India already qualified for the Super Four stage, this match serves as a final opportunity for the team to fine-tune their strategies and gain valuable batting practice ahead of the upcoming high-stakes encounters.
Match Details
- Date: September 19, 2025
- Time: 7:30 PM IST / 6:00 PM UAE Time
- Venue: Sheikh Zayed Cricket Stadium, Abu Dhabi
- Format: T20 International
- Live Streaming: JioHotstar and Star Sports (India)

Recent Form
| Team | Matches | Wins | Losses | Win % |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| India | 2 | 2 | 0 | 100% |
| Oman | 2 | 0 | 2 | 0% |
India enters this match with a perfect record in the group stage, having secured victories against Pakistan and the UAE. Oman, in contrast, has faced defeats in both their matches, making this encounter crucial for them to gain experience and confidence.
Venue & Conditions
The Sheikh Zayed Cricket Stadium in Abu Dhabi is known for its balanced pitch, offering assistance to both batsmen and bowlers. Early overs may favor fast bowlers, while spinners are expected to play a significant role as the match progresses. The average first-innings score at this venue is approximately 160 runs.
